What are compound exercises and why are they good for you?

By Mandy Hagstrom, Senior Lecturer, Exercise Physiology. School of Health Sciences, UNSW Sydney
Anurag Pandit, PhD Candidate in Exercise Physiology, UNSW Sydney
You could consider prioritising compound exercises if you’re time poor, interested in healthy ageing and looking for an efficient way to train many muscles and joints in the one workout.The Conversation
